Ransomware Groups Prioritize Backup Tampering, Making Recovery Readiness Critical for Resilience

What Happened — Recent ransomware research shows > 90 % of attacks now attempt to delete or corrupt backups before the payload executes, and ≈ 60 % of those attempts succeed. The trend signals that merely having copies of data is no longer sufficient; organizations must prove they can restore operations quickly enough to avoid prolonged downtime and loss of customer trust.

Why It Matters for Compliance & Audit Readiness

  • SOC 2’s Availability principle requires documented, testable recovery procedures—not just backup storage.
  • Continuous‑compliance programs must map backup/recovery controls to the “CC6.1 – System Operations” and “CC7.1 – Business Continuity” criteria and retain evidence of regular recovery drills.

Who Is Affected – Enterprises across all sectors that rely on hybrid on‑prem/cloud workloads, especially SMBs and mid‑market firms that have under‑invested in recovery infrastructure.

Recommended Actions

  • Extend your SOC 2 control inventory to include a dedicated “Recovery Readiness” control set (e.g., immutable backups, automated restore testing).
  • Deploy continuous evidence collection for recovery drills and map that evidence to SOC 2 Availability and Business Continuity criteria.
  • Validate that backup repositories are protected by immutable storage and that recovery time objectives (RTOs) meet business‑critical thresholds.

Technical Notes – The threat vector is primarily identity‑based credential compromise that gives attackers privileged access to backup repositories; attackers then use ransomware to encrypt or delete those backups. No specific CVE is cited; the risk stems from process and configuration gaps rather than a software flaw. Source: same article
